8edde8cee137db1ce272e864efc929ba97a6faf26fcee82940c763796c813574

1791619 (36603 blocks ago)

⏴ Block 1791618 (682d83b2…991) | Block 1791620 ⏵ | Latest block ⏭

Metadata

26/02/2025, 00:40 UTC (50d 20:06:51 ago) 19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details